Everyone knows that having a sedentary lifestyle and eating more than necessary can keep excess pounds from going away. Sadly, there are actually so many other saboteurs of weight loss Marlborough MA residents are not aware of. Knowing some of them is so important for the attainment of one's dream figure without going through much trouble and despair.

Limiting your food or caloric intake can prevent your waistline from shrinking in no time. Everyone knows that fad diets encourage severe restriction of calories on an everyday basis. Fitness authorities say, however, that this can in fact keep you from attaining your preferred figure. That's because a diet that is extremely low in calories can keep your metabolism from running smoothly.

Opting for sugar-free treats can do more harm than good. Scientists confirm that artificial sweeteners can in fact encourage gaining of excess pounds as it can leave an individual addicted to foods and beverages that actually contain lots of refined sugar. What's more, the consumption of sugar-free products tends to leave a person thinking that it's perfectly fine to overeat as well as steer clear of exercising, both of which are very important for slimming down.

Having food products that are low in or free of fat can do more harm rather than good. That's because a little fat is so important for satiety, thus saving you from overeating every mealtime. By the way, studies say that a lot of those low-fat or fat-free products tend to be loaded with calories.

Having a very stressful lifestyle can keep the body from becoming slimmer. Flooding the bloodstream with stress hormones all the time can trigger a voracious appetite. Similarly, it can encourage the waistline to expand. This is deemed essential by the body in an attempt to increase the amount of fuel reserves and also ensure that the various organs located in the midsection have enough protection.

Lack of sleep can make it harder to eliminate those unwanted kilos. According to scientists, sleeplessness is a form of stress. In addition, it can wreak havoc on the individual's mood. Everyone knows that being depressed can cause overeating to feel quite comforting. Foods and drinks preferred by most depressed people are fattening ones.

Suffering from some medical issues can keep weight loss from happening. One example of those is an under active thyroid that's referred to as hypothyroidism by the medical community. Various bodily processes end up running sluggishly as a result of hypothyroidism, and one of those is the metabolic rate.

In some instances, it is a good idea to consult a doctor if slimming down proves to be really difficult. That's because it may be due to a condition or an illness that needs to be identified and treated accordingly. Someone who is given a clean bill of health may consider hiring experts such as a personal trainer and dietitian in order to obtain results safely and effectively.
